RKAV Volendam meet Hoek in the Tweede Divisie regular season - 4 at KWABO-stadion, Volendam.
The baseline ratings are close, 1500 to 1535, so form and chance quality carry more weight here. Recent form separates little, 48% against 53%. Attacking output favors Hoek on expected goals, 1.8 to 1.4 per match.
RKAV Volendam arrive steady: 2W-1D-2L from their last five (7/15 pts), 7 scored and 11 conceded. Recent results: W 2-1 v Hoek, D 1-1 @ Ijsselmeervogels, W 2-1 v Spakenburg, L 0-5 @ Quick Boys.
Hoek are patchy: 1W-1D-3L from their last five (4/15 pts, 2 straight defeats), 6 scored and 8 conceded. Recent results: L 1-2 @ RKAV Volendam, L 0-2 v Spakenburg, D 1-1 @ Katwijk, W 3-1 v Koninklijke HFC.
Hoek hold the recent head-to-head, 3 wins to 2 across the last 5 meetings. Most recently they met in 2026: RKAV Volendam 2-1 Hoek.
